BIOGRAPHY

Fumiko Katsuragi was a prominent figure in Japanese cinema during the 1930s, leaving an indelible mark on film history that continues to captivate collectors of physical media. Best known for her performances in classics like *Our Neighbor, Miss Yae* (1934) and *Street Without End* (1934), Katsuragi's work exemplifies the emotional depth and innovative storytelling of pre-war Japanese cinema. Her role in *Mother and Child* (1938) further solidified her status as a versatile actress, showcasing her ability to navigate complex narratives that resonate even today. Collectors actively seek out Katsuragi's films, particularly for their historical significance and rarity in home video formats. Titles like *Okoto and Sasuke* (1935) and *The Genealogy of Women* (1934) are especially prized, not only for their artistic merit but also for their representation of a pivotal era in Japanese film.
